The difference that a 120Hz screen makes
The standard until recently was 60Hz on smartphone screens. This means that the screen had the ability to update itself 60 times per second. Thus, it will be able to update itself 120 times, which means that you will have a much more fluid experience.
It is good to remember that in 2017 Apple already bet on a 120Hz refresh rate on its iPad Pro (the one it calls ProMotion). However, they do have LCD screens, while the new iPhone will have AMOLED screens.
It is good to remember that the battery of the equipment will suffer if you use the screen at 120Hz. However, if that is not a priority, it is a feature that you will be able to “turn off”, thus saving the battery of your new smartphone.
